Azerbaijan defeats Faroe Islands in UEFA Nations League.

By Abdul Kerimkhanov

The Azerbaijani national football team in the away match against the team of the Faroe Islands won a convincing victory with a score of 3:0.

The game of the third round of the League of Nations Group 3 Division D between the football teams of Azerbaijan and the Faroe Islands took place on Thursday, October 11, in Torshavn.

Team of Gurban Gurbanov opened the scoring in the 28th minute of the meeting. Richard Almeida marked the exact blow.

After the break, Dmitri Nazarov doubled advantage of Azerbaijani team, scoring the second goal against the home side.

At the 85th minute of the match, Ruslan Gurbanov was shot down in the penalty area. The penalty appointed by the referee was realized by Richard Almeida.

In another match of the third round of the League of Nations Group 3 Division D, the national team of Kosovo beat the team of Malta. The meeting was held in Pristina (Kosovo) at the Fadil Vokri stadium and ended with the score 3-1 in favor of the hosts.

Thus, after three rounds, the Kosovo national team remains the leader of the group with 7 points.

Having won the first victory in the group, the Azerbaijani team rose to the second place in the group.

The Faroe Islands and Malta are ranked third and fourth with 3 and 1 points respectively.

The next matches in the group will be held on October 14. On their field, the team of the Faroe Islands will play with the team of Kosovo. The Azerbaijani team in Baku will try to get a second victory in a row in a match against Malta.
